productivity
wow. alot was accomplished today. jeremy may/or may not be finished with his drums. that’s just crazy talk! but yes, he has now tracked all of his parts. he will now move on to editing what he’s played. well actually, mark (shane’s assistant) has been locked in his hotel room since monday or tuesday, he is turning pale from lack of sunlight, editing everything (as in, lining things up, making sure the ups and downs are where they need to be.) and now jeremy will be editing away making them extra special. if there is anything additional needed we’ll go back and grab it but yes, drums may be finished at this point.
oh, and, the first thing that happened this morning was taylor (aka the kid) tracked his guitar parts on the title track, “remedy.” oh my word! i’m flipping out. they are so epic. after dinner, mike d dumped the bass stuff he had been messing with for “rain down” so guitars can track to it. then taylor and jack started on “we won’t be quiet.” it’s this big cbgb rocker type bit. an ode to the resplendent club that is no longer. well except in vegas, we think.
the one bit of lameness is that some ungodly mass of phlegm has taken up residence in my head and throat. i’m not sure if it’s just alergies or what but we were no longer playing at ubc in the morning due to it. lame. hopefully this heap of foulness will move on before it is time for vocals.
but yes, it is fact, that currently, a bar of harmony lead guitars happen in “we won’t be quiet.”
